Joe Odagiri is a prolific and versatile Japanese actor who has captivated audiences with his dynamic performances across a wide range of films. Known for his magnetic screen presence and nuanced ability to inhabit diverse roles, Odagiri has established himself as one of the most compelling actors in contemporary Japanese cinema. Odagiri's breakthrough came with his starring turn as the titular hero in the 2000 tokusatsu series "Kamen Rider Kuuga," a role that showcased his physicality and ability to convey both strength and vulnerability. Since then, he has gone on to appear in a remarkable array of films, from the poignant drama "The Moon" to the lighthearted comedy "The Solitary Gourmet." Whether playing a brooding antihero or a quirky everyman, Odagiri consistently brings a compelling intensity and depth to his performances, captivating audiences with his emotional range and commitment to each role. Equally adept at drama, action, and comedy, Odagiri's filmography reflects his versatility and willingness to take on challenging, unconventional projects. From the surreal sci-fi of "Bring Him Down to a Portable Size" to the heartwarming slice-of-life of "On Summer Sand," he demonstrates a remarkable ability to inhabit a wide variety of characters and genres, cementing his status as one of Japan's most dynamic and unpredictable leading men.
